Understanding the Role of AI and Digital Twins in Urban Management

As cities evolve into more complex ecosystems, the integration of artificial intelligence (AI) and digital twins is becoming increasingly vital. These technologies serve as the intelligent operating layer for urban environments, enabling better decision-making, operational efficiency, and enhanced citizen engagement.

In an OnDemand Webinar, city officials and technology experts gathered to discuss the implications of AI on urban management, emphasizing the importance of laying a robust data groundwork. The discussion highlighted Sunderland's proactive approach in preparing for AI adoption, illustrating how cities can leverage data to improve their services.

AI for Personalized Government Services

Another key topic covered in the OnDemand Trend Report Panel Discussion was the potential of AI to create personalized government services. Panelists discussed strategies to build trust and inclusivity within urban populations, focusing on how tailored services can meet the diverse needs of citizens.

AI technologies can analyze vast amounts of data collected from various sources, allowing city administrations to identify patterns and preferences among residents. This capability ensures that services are not only more efficient but also more responsive to the unique demands of different community segments.

Moreover, the integration of digital twins—virtual replicas of physical entities—offers a revolutionary approach to city planning and management. By simulating various scenarios, city planners can visualize the impact of potential changes before implementing them, minimizing risks and maximizing benefits.

Building Trust Through Transparency

For AI-driven solutions to gain acceptance, transparency is paramount. Cities must communicate how data is collected, used, and protected to foster trust among residents. The panelists shared insights into best practices for creating open channels of communication and involving citizens in the decision-making process.

Inclusivity is another crucial aspect, as technology must serve all residents, including marginalized groups. Urban planners are encouraged to engage with diverse communities to ensure that AI developments address their specific needs and concerns.
